Output 27017679f225260352383dc89ecb069863edc044fceddd051c1cc014e7613c06:1

value
334923785
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e5c13db5edc983c7d714c0c2ac9cbc673265346 OP_EQUALVERIFY OP_CHECKSIG
address
DDk2MxAcFyvQELzacjJhypRgVmF5uHw3sQ
transaction
27017679f225260352383dc89ecb069863edc044fceddd051c1cc014e7613c06